Senior Theatre Practitioner


We are looking for a Senior Theatre Practitioner to join an incredible Private Hospital based in Guildford. This is a full-time role for 37.5 hours a week, covering a flexible shift pattern across seven days, including on-call. The role comes with a salary of £44,000.00 and excellent benefits. As a Senior Theatre Practitioner, you will work on developing their services and grow their theatre team. You will also deliver quality care for patients during their perioperative phase of care. In your first few weeks in this Senior Theatre Practitioner role, you can expect to: Deliver safe, quality care for patients during their perioperative phase of care Support and assist in the management and organisation of care provision within the operating department Manage and manage a team, coordinating staff training needs and resource requirements within a peri-operative function or surgical speciality Assist in the delivery of patient care. To apply, you will need to be a Registered Practitioner with NMC or HCPC registration and have a minimum of three years' experience in coordination, ordering, mentor, overview of guiding others. You will also require the following: Additional skills in recovery and anaesthetics ILS Mentorship qualification Proficiency in the use of a PC, including using software and systems Experience in customer care, including interacting with customers in challenging situations.
